The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Dawes, born in 1821 in Brentford, Middlesex, consisted of 3 members. James was the head of the household, married to Adelaide F Dawes, born in 1823 in Middlesex, England. They had 1 grandchild; Frank, born 1878 in Kennington, Surrey, England.
